Media release: Suncorp dumps thermal coal

26 July 2019 In response to Market Forces lodging a shareholder resolution, Suncorp has revealed it is exiting the thermal coal sector, meaning there are now no Australian insurers willing to underwrite new thermal coal mines and power stations.
